The Significance of Boss Battles in Digital Fishing Ecosystems

Unlike traditional fishing simulations that focus solely on patience and timing, contemporary digital fishing games integrate **boss battles** as a core feature to invigorate gameplay. These encounters serve as high-stakes challenges that test a player’s skill in casting, timing, and resource management. The allure of confronting a formidable ‘boss’—a large, often mythic creature—adds a narrative drive and a sense of achievement upon victory.

Strategic Importance of Multipliers and Their Impact

Multipliers are a critical component, often incentivised through gameplay systems that reward skillful play, risk-taking, or bonus activity. They multiply the points, catch value, or rewards earned from specific actions, effectively allowing players to scale their success exponentially during a session.

In practice, an improved understanding and strategic application of multipliers during boss encounters can significantly enhance a player’s overall performance. This system, when finely tuned, creates a rewarding feedback loop that encourages continued engagement and mastery. Designing Engaging Boss Encounters: A Case Study Approach

Feature Implementation Strategy Player Engagement Impact
Visual and Audio Cues Dynamic cues signal boss phases and vulnerabilities, encouraging observational play. Increases immersion and strategic planning time.
Reward Multipliers Triggered through skillful actions or timing windows within boss phases. Enhances thrill and incentivizes mastering complex mechanics.
Progressive Difficulty & Rewards Scaling boss health and attack in tandem with multiplier opportunities. Maintains challenge, sustains long-term interest.
